GRILLED SHRIMP SKEWERS WITH TOMATO, GARLIC & HERBS



Grilled Shrimp Skewers with Tomato, Garlic & Herbs image

Shrimp marinated in a mix of olive oil, tomato paste, lemon, garlic & herbs and then grilled until slightly charred.

Provided by Jennifer Segal

Categories     Dinner

Time 1h20m

Yield 4 - 6

Number Of Ingredients 11

2½ tablespoons tomato paste
6 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
1 large shallot, roughly chopped
4 large cloves garlic, roughly chopped
¼ cup fresh basil leaves, chopped
1 tablespoon fresh thyme leaves (or 1 teaspoon dried)
¼ teaspoon red pepper flakes
1½ teaspoons sugar
1 teaspoon salt
2 pounds jumbo shrimp (21-25 per pound), peeled and de-veined (leave tails on if desired), thawed if frozen

Steps:

  • To make the marinade, combine all of the ingredients except for the shrimp in a mini food processor or blender; blend until the mixture forms a smooth paste.
  • Combine the shrimp and the marinade in a medium bowl and stir until shrimp are evenly coated. Let marinate at room temperature for 30 minutes - 1 hour.
  • Preheat the grill to medium-high heat. Meanwhile, thread the shrimp onto skewers (going through the top and bottom of each shrimp). Lightly dip a wad of paper towels in vegetable oil and, using tongs, carefully rub over grates several times until glossy and coated. Grill the shrimp skewers about 1½ minutes per side. Be sure not to overcook! Serve hot, room temperature or cold.
  • *If you're entertaining and want to get everything done ahead of time, you can thread the shrimp onto the skewers right after mixing with the marinade.

GRILLED SHRIMP SKEWERS MARINATED IN AN ORANGE-CHAMPAGNE VINAIGRETTE



Grilled Shrimp Skewers Marinated in an Orange-Champagne Vinaigrette image

Provided by Sandra Lee

Categories     appetizer

Time 15m

Yield 5 servings

Number Of Ingredients 6

2 tablespoons Champagne wine vinegar
1 tablespoons orange olive oil
1 tablespoon Italian dressing mix
1 orange
1 pound large shrimp, peeled and deveined
20 cherry tomatoes

Steps:

  • In a medium bowl, combine Champagne vinegar, orange olive oil, and dressing mix. Cut orange and squeeze for juice. Add shrimp and toss to coat. Set aside.
  • Make rosemary skewers by stripping off all the leaves except the top of 5-inch rosemary stalks. Set aside.
  • Skewer the shrimp and tomatoes by putting 1 shrimp followed by 1 cherry tomato on each rosemary skewer. Wrap the leafy end of the rosemary in the foil squares to prevent from burning during grilling.
  • Grill on preheated grill for about 2 minutes per side or until the shrimp turns pink. Remove foil from ends of skewers and serve.

GRILLED SHRIMP WITH BACON, TOMATO AND SCALLION VINAIGRETTE



Grilled Shrimp with Bacon, Tomato and Scallion Vinaigrette image

Provided by Bobby Flay

Categories     appetizer

Time 1h35m

Yield 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 10

8 ounces slab bacon, rind removed, cut into large dice
2 tablespoons canola oil, plus more for brushing
6 plum tomatoes, cored and diced
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
3 tablespoons chopped fresh cilantro
3 tablespoons red wine vinegar
2 teaspoons chopped fresh thyme
3 green onions, green and pale green parts, thinly sliced
16 large shrimp, peeled and deveined, heads off

Steps:

  • Put the bacon in a cast-iron skillet over medium heat and cook, stirring occasionally, until the bacon is crisp and the fat is rendered.
  • When the bacon is just about done, heat the canola oil in a nonreactive skillet over medium-high heat. Add the tomatoes and salt and pepper and cook, stirring, just until slightly softened. Using a slotted spoon, transfer the bacon to the skillet with the tomatoes and add the cilantro, vinegar, thyme and green onions. Cook, stirring, until heated through, about 5 minutes. Set aside; keep warm.
  • Heat a charcoal or gas grill to high for direct grilling.
  • Brush the shrimp with canola oil and sprinkle with salt and pepper. Using two skewers at a time, thread four shrimp on the skewers near the tail and head ends--this makes it easier to flip the shrimp on the grill. Grill until slightly charred and cooked through, about 2 minutes per side.
  • Remove the shrimp from the skewers and top with the warm vinaigrette.

TOMATO-BASIL SHRIMP SKEWERS



Tomato-Basil Shrimp Skewers image

I promise you that these are THE best, most perfectly seasoned shrimp you will ever eat. My husband doesn't normally care for shrimp, but he raves over these! -Jennifer Fulk, Moreno Valley, California

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 40m

Yield 6 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 7

1/3 cup olive oil
1/4 cup tomato sauce
2 tablespoons minced fresh basil
2 tablespoons red wine vinegar
1-1/2 teaspoons minced garlic
1/4 teaspoon cayenne pepper
2 pounds uncooked jumbo shrimp, peeled and deveined

Steps:

  • In a large resealable plastic bag, combine the first six ingredients; add shrimp. Seal bag and turn to coat; refrigerate for up to 30 minutes. , Drain and discard marinade. Thread shrimp onto six metal or soaked wooden skewers. Grill, covered, over medium heat for 3-5 minutes on each side or until shrimp turn pink, turning once.

GRILLED SHRIMP SKEWERS WITH ROASTED RED PEPPER SAUCE



Grilled Shrimp Skewers With Roasted Red Pepper Sauce image

Fresh wild shrimp from the Gulf of Mexico (and the Atlantic coast off the Carolinas and Georgia) are the best option for shrimp lovers. Leave them in the shell, which keeps them juicy, before threading on skewers to grill. These are seasoned only with a little salt, then served with a spicy red pepper sauce that takes cues from the Catalan romesco.

Provided by David Tanis

Categories     dinner, seafood, main course

Time 1h

Yield 4 to 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 13

2 large red bell peppers
3/4 cup whole toasted almonds (see Tip)
1 teaspoon pimentón (smoked Spanish paprika)
1/4 teaspoon ground cayenne
3 garlic cloves, minced
Salt and pepper
1 cup extra-virgin olive oil
Lemon wedges, for serving
1 1/2 pounds very small potatoes, unpeeled
3 medium red onions, unpeeled and quartered
Salt
1 1/2 to 2 pounds fresh Gulf shrimp, or use frozen
Extra-virgin olive oil

Steps:

  • Prepare a hot charcoal grill. Lay peppers directly on the grill and let them blister, turning frequently until blackened all over, about 8 minutes. Set aside on a plate until cool enough to handle. (Alternatively, roast peppers on the stovetop, directly on the flames of a gas burner.)
  • Cut peppers in half lengthwise. Cut off stems, scrape away skins and seeds, and discard. Do not rinse; a bit of char is OK. Chop the peppers into 2-inch chunks.
  • With a food processor or blender, whirl together peppers, almonds, pimentón, cayenne and garlic to form a rough paste. Season with salt and pepper. Slowly add olive oil to achieve the consistency of a thick milkshake. Taste, adjust seasoning and transfer to a serving bowl.
  • In a medium saucepan, boil potatoes in well-salted water until just done, about 10 minutes. Drain.
  • Place onion pieces on the grill skin-side down. Salt lightly. Cover with lid and cook until onions are soft, about 15 minutes. Set aside and keep warm.
  • Place boiled potatoes on grill and cook until slightly charred, 8 to 10 minutes. Set aside and keep warm.
  • Meanwhile, thread shrimp onto skewers, 4 or 5 shrimp per skewer, without crowding. (If using bamboo skewers, soak them in water to prevent burning.) Brush lightly with olive oil and sprinkle with salt.
  • Lay skewers on grill over hot coals. Cook for about 3 minutes, then flip and cook until shrimp turn pink and are a bit charred, 3 minutes more
  • Arrange shrimp, potatoes and onions on a large platter. Serve with the red pepper sauce and lemon wedges.
